HANDOVER — Commission Scheme Revision

To the incoming director: the revised scheme goes live on the 1st. Key changes: accelerators start at 110% of quota, not 100%; multi-year Quillstone deals pay out over term, not upfront; clawbacks extend to nine months. Reps were briefed last week — expect pushback from the Ashgrove pod. Payroll mapping is done; Tomas owns the calculator. Disputes route through RevOps, not you. One outstanding item: the enterprise override rate is unresolved. Background for that decision sits below.

internal memo for kahif-kawig: Project Fravan slips by two quarters because of the tooling delay.

Handover note — Bramblewick consent banner rollout

Hi all — handing this off before I rotate to the Mossvale team. The consent banner is live in the Ostermark region and dark-launched everywhere else. Rollout percentage is controlled server-side; do not flip it client-side, that caused the flicker bug in week one. New folks: the banner copy is localized, but the consent categories are fixed in config. If anything regresses, roll the percentage back to zero first, ask questions later. The current rollout configuration is as follows.

service settings:
PRAWYN_PIN=9848
PRAWYN_METRICS_HOST=metrics.prawyn.lumicworks.corp
PRAWYN_LOG_LEVEL=warn
PRAWYN_TENANT=pelius

## Rate limiting

The Marrowline gateway throttles internal callers per service token. New team members: never disable the limiter in prod. If a client is being throttled unexpectedly, check their bucket assignment first, then recent deploys. Overrides go through the config repo, not the admin console. Escalate sustained 429 storms to the platform channel. The limiter boots with the following configuration values.

config for kafof-bawef:
holath:
  log_level: debug
  metrics_host: metrics.holath.qorvelsys.internal
  pin: 2191
  pool_size: 32

Subject: Interview room bookings — read this

Team assistants: all candidate interviews now go in Room 4B, the secure room behind the Marwick Wing front desk. Book through the Tellsen calendar, not verbally. Escort candidates in and out yourselves — no unaccompanied access. Blinds stay down during sessions. The door auto-locks; don't wedge it. If the panel beeps red, try once more before calling me. Use the code below to enter.

staff pass of kawip-hawef = bdg-QLP-2